At the thalamic degree, pain pathways have two main websites of termination: ventrocaudal and medial. The ventrocaudal thalamus gets nociceptive input straight from projecting spinal neurons. Neurons while in the ventrocaudal thalamus venture directly to the somatosensory cortex (Willis, 1985). The medial thalamus gets some indirect input from the spinal cord, but Moreover, it gets A serious enter with the location with the brain stem reticular development to which the nociceptive spinoreticular neurons venture.

For this type of pain, the region of research concentrates primarily on the afferent element as it has been shown which the administration of some prescription drugs, including neighborhood anesthetics, will be able to relieve ongoing neuropathic pain [157]. The continuing afferent activity could act in other ways so that you can induce adjustments in transduction. The mechanisms can vary and may involve the expression of transducers in neurons that normally never express this sort of transducer, the increase in expression of excitatory receptors [158], and/or perhaps the lessen of inhibitory transducers [159]. A different system would be the expression of thermal or mechanical transducers close to the extremity of your Minimize, damaged axon [159], or In the ganglia [one hundred sixty]. It is plausible to hypothesize that the assorted procedures occur and collaborate simultaneously to lead to the continuing exercise inside the afferents affected during nerve personal injury. The origins of your exercise may well involve, as previously mentioned, the ectopic expression of transducers [161]. One example would be the anomalous activation of nociceptors by norepinephrine which results from the sympathetic article-ganglionic terminals which have been expressed on ganglia [162] as well as alteration in expression and density of ion channels that brings about instability and spontaneous action around the membrane [163]. These mechanisms of exercise are not simply a consequence on the damage but are prone to be considered a result of the various changes that occur as time passes. For these factors, neuropathic pain is difficult to manage.
